I carefully cut and glued together multiple layers of corrugated cardboard to form the frame, then painted it with blue acrylic paint and applied a sealant to make it look finished. I carved a little slot in the back to use to hang it on the wall.
Of course a frame isn’t complete with out something to frame, right? I got the idea for a silhouette with glitter from this tutorial on Naughty Secretary Club. I made it on this cute piece of scrapbook paper and outlined the butterfly with fabric paint. Simply done and it really makes a statement. Does it send the right message though?
